Moulded Shoe in New York is a captivating store. A family-run enterprise now in its third technology, It’s slender and tall, with shoe containers stacked means as much as a double-height ceiling. 

There are newspaper cuttings, buyer photographs and a Japanese cartoon on the partitions. It’s from the quaint – and delightfully so – ‘extra is extra’ faculty of retailing. 

Nonetheless, as a garments lover it’s unlikely you’d assume there’s a lot right here for you. They clearly promote Alden, however absolutely the Alden retailer on Madison can have every little thing this retailer may have? 

Not so. For this is likely one of the only a few retailers the place you will get the modified final. 

The modified final from Alden creates a selected form of shoe, with a slim waist, broad entrance and barely bent inwards on the toes, following the form of the foot (under). 

It’s a form that’s extra orthopaedic, maybe prioritising consolation and performance slightly over aesthetics – not like most costume footwear. It fits males with a slender heel, broad joints (generally known as a ‘spade’ form) and excessive arches, which is a reasonably large minority. 

The modified final shouldn’t be bought extensively as a result of it’s thought of to be barely odd, even ugly. Definitely, no shoe designer who was centered on design would make a shoe like this. 

Nonetheless, this repute is likely to be exaggerated by the truth that the opposite store identified for promoting the modified final, Antomica in Paris, places males in relatively massive sizes. Pierre and Charles are likely to insist on it

Anatomica is a superb menswear store – a kind of locations that also stays a real vacation spot – and needs to be celebrated and regularly visited. However it’s relatively irritating which you can’t purchase the modified final within the measurement you need. 

Therefore my go to to Moulded Shoe in New York, and therefore the dialog I’m having with the proprietor Ronnie. 

“Pierre first noticed the modified final right here,” he says, unlacing a boot for me to strive. “He got here in right here and beloved the form, so he talked to Alden about providing it in his shops.”

I inquire in regards to the preferences for sizing. 

“Sure, they have a tendency to choose extra of a ‘trend’ match – longer and narrower. He thinks it’s flattering,” he says. 

I’m unsure about whether or not it’s extra a trend factor or not – definitely there’s extra trend occurring at Anatomica than Moulded Shoe, nevertheless it’s not precisely French couture both.

Nonetheless, the distinction in sizing was dramatic. After a fast measurement on the American-specific (‘Brannock’) scale, Maurice steered a measurement 9B. Anatomica had really helpful a ten.5C. 

The match felt excellent: shut by the arch and ankle, however with loads of room to wiggle the toes. A greater match than most ready-to-wear I’ve, and in some methods higher than some bespoke.

On that authentic article in regards to the modified final, reader ‘Plop’ received it just about spot on. In his expertise, he stated he’d advocate sizing down a half measurement on the modified, and maybe a measurement narrower. I are likely to put on a 9D in wider Alden lasts and a 9.5D in narrower ones.

I purchased a pair of half-brogue boots in snuff suede (D8814), pushed by the match and the actual fact it might be my solely probability to buy at Moulded Shoe (Alden don’t permit them to ship exterior the US). 

I believe the final form works nicely in a boot as a result of its idiosyncrasies are slightly obscured by the design. However nonetheless, it’s the smaller measurement that makes the distinction: if you’re not carrying a shoe that’s a full measurement greater than you’d usually put on, the curved form is rather a lot much less apparent.

The final works notably nicely on me as a result of I’ve that ‘spade’ form described earlier. (In case you have flat ft or are wider within the heel, the Berrie or Trubalance lasts from Alden are higher.)

However I do know many different males do too – you solely need to learn the variety of feedback from readers asking about sizing in loafers, saying their heel all the time slips out. Chatting to Tony Gaziano a number of weeks in the past, he estimated that maybe 20% of Gaziano & Girling clients fall into that bracket. Maybe sufficient to justify a devoted idler final for some manufacturers. 

It is in that context that the comment above in regards to the match of bespoke footwear needs to be taken. This one final works notably nicely on me, and bespoke makers are sometimes attempting to create it from scratch. 

In fact, it is also not a good comparability as a result of these makers try to create a really visually engaging present on the similar time. 

But it surely feels vital that whereas we had been within the retailer, a reader did are available in (pictured high) that had tried bespoke makers, been unhappy, and been really helpful to strive the modified final as a substitute. From a purely match perspective, it may possibly clearly fill a distinct segment.

Moulded Shoe promote different shoe manufacturers, although not on the similar degree as Alden, they usually make bespoke footwear, costing $1500-$2500 – however actual orthopaedics. 

They do not make bespoke loafers full cease, as a result of they assume a laced shoe will all the time match a buyer higher.
